All our fears can be encapsulated in three words: security, life, and justification. But the Bible repeatedly tells us, “Fear not!” So how do we live without fear? In this episode, the WHI hosts consider how fear can shift from terror to trust, from law and gospel. They examine the biblical promises that undergird the commands to fear not, celebrating the comfort found in facing our fears united to Christ.
